Uh Huh Her - October 12th, 2011 - 9:30 Club

October is Breast Cancer Awareness month and Uh Huh Her are doing their part to spread the word. On tour under the moniker of Keep A Breast, the tour touched down in Washington DC at the 9:30 Club on October 12th and we were lucky to brave the rainy night and catch their set. Do have to admit that the fact that Bobby Alt was on drums for them on this tours as definitely a plus as it's been so long since I have seen him! The early doors for this show proved to be a bit of a hindrance as rush hour traffic combined with the rain made for a slow travel, but the floor of the club filled in just prior to their set. The set combined older material with newer as the band had just released Nocturnes the day prior. Regardless of whether it was new material or old material, the audience, albeit not packed, was one that was totally tuned into the performance. Not having seen Uh Huh Her prior to this, they definitely reminded me of much of the music I grew up loving from the 80s. A note of irony for the night, Camila Grey's voice has a tone that made me wish to hear her cover Siouxie and the Banshee's "Cities in Dust?. I had thought that during the show and then noted the t-shirt that Bobby Alt was wearing - Siouxsie and the Banshees.
